Transaction a2e21f51166c280ee9f21345cf0bc1526241032601f085631ad2e440f06fa195

5 Input
2 Outputs
  • a2e21f51166c280ee9f21345cf0bc1526241032601f085631ad2e440f06fa195:0
  • value  21000000
    address  3H2DjMvkD9qSEeAEn25dCFkSQScGdiUpQn
  • a2e21f51166c280ee9f21345cf0bc1526241032601f085631ad2e440f06fa195:1
  • value  20468271
    address  3769FMoDW3wdVgHGCt8TLf7NG1CidwFFit